Healthcare Practice IT Salary

How much does the Healthcare Practice IT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Healthcare Practice IT in the United States is $100,786.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$48. Salaries at Healthcare Practice IT typically range from $88,804 to $113,708 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Healthcare Practice IT’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Santa Ana?

Understanding the cost of living near Santa Ana is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Healthcare Practice IT.
Santa Ana's Cost of Living Index is approximately 149.7 (49.7% more expensive than US average; 7.1% more than CA average). Orange County seat, high housing costs, though often slightly more affordable than neighboring Irvine or coastal OC cities. When planning your budget based on a salary from Healthcare Practice IT,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,000 - $2,900+ A significant portion of Healthcare Practice IT sal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$69 (OCT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$670 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$740+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,459 - $5,329+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
